Littré indicates that there is a form tardone, the metathesis of /r/ is evident. In the origin of the names of birds and mammals of Europe, it is given as derived from an acoustic radical tard, just like Turdidae and outarde, specifying for the latter that the classical etymology of avis tarda (\"slow bird\") is unjustified for those who know its rapid flight.
